Universal Audio Announces Apollo Twin Thunderbolt Audio Interface

At the 2014 NAMM Show, Universal Audio introduced the Apollo Twin High-Resolution Desktop Interface with Realtime UAD Processing. The 2×6 Thunderbolt audio interface for Mac combines the 24/192 kHz audio conversion of Universal Audio’s Apollo series with onboard Realtime UAD SOLO or DUO Processing. Alesis Intros Core Line Of Audio Interfaces

2014 NAMM Show: Alesis has announced the new CORE Series of 24-bit USB Audio Interfaces. The audio interfaces offer XLR+1/4″ combo inputs, Mic/Line or Guitar level switching, headphone outputs with level controls for efficient monitoring, and each model ships with Cubase 7 LE.
